Sen. Bob Casey and GOP Challenger Tom Smith will debate, both campaigns announced Friday afternoon. The event will take place on Friday October 26 at WPVI’s studio in Philadelphia.

The DCCC trimmed its TV presence by about $225K in the Pittsburgh market, and it looks like Larry Maggi is cut off. They’ll still be on TV in the 12th district, but as of today Republican Keith Rothfus will have a 3-2 TV advantage over Rep. Mark Critz in the final 3 weeks of the campaign.

Democrat Kathleen Kane leads her Republican opponent Dave Freed 41 percent to 29 according to a poll commissioned by the Philadelphia Inquirer. 30 percent of voters remain undecided.
Is it time to hold the phone on the “Smith surge”? A poll commissioned by the Philadelphia Inquirer shows Sen. Bob Casey with a strong lead over Republican challenger Tom Smith.
